Leading National Dailies
In India, the print media plays a significant role in disseminating news and information to the masses. Among the numerous national dailies, some stand out for their credibility, circulation, and impact. Here are some of the leading national dailies in India:
The Times of India is one of the most widely read and respected national dailies in India. With a circulation of over 3.5 million copies, it is the largest English-language daily in the country. The Times of India is known for its in-depth coverage of national and international news, as well as its investigative reporting.
The Hindu is another prominent national daily in India, with a circulation of over 1.5 million copies. It is known for its balanced and unbiased reporting, as well as its in-depth coverage of national and international news. The Hindu is also famous for its editorial pages, which are known for their thought-provoking articles and opinions.
The Indian Express is a popular national daily in India, with a circulation of over 1 million copies. It is known for its investigative reporting and in-depth coverage of national and international news. The Indian Express is also famous for its editorial pages, which are known for their sharp and incisive commentary.
The Hindustan Times is another prominent national daily in India, with a circulation of over 750,000 copies. It is known for its in-depth coverage of national and international news, as well as its investigative reporting. The Hindustan Times is also famous for its editorial pages, which are known for their thought-provoking articles and opinions.
These leading national dailies in India are not only widely read but also respected for their credibility and impact. They play a significant role in shaping public opinion and holding those in power accountable.

Regional News Outlets
India is a diverse country with 29 states and 7 union territories, each with its unique culture, language, and news landscape. Regional news outlets play a crucial role in catering to the specific needs of these regions. For instance, the Andhra Pradesh-based Sakshi Post is a leading Telugu-language news outlet, while the Maharashtra-based Lokmat is a prominent Marathi-language newspaper.
Another example is the Tamil-language news outlet, Dinamalar, which is widely read in the southern state of Tamil Nadu. These regional news outlets not only provide local news but also offer a platform for regional voices to be heard.
Language-Specific News Outlets
India is a multilingual country, and language-specific news outlets cater to the diverse linguistic landscape. For instance, the Hindi-language news outlet, Aaj Tak, is a popular source of news for Hindi-speaking audiences, while the Malayalam-language news outlet, Mathrubhumi, is a leading source of news for Malayalam-speaking audiences.
Language-specific news outlets like the Telugu-language news outlet, Andhra Jyoti, and the Kannada-language news outlet, Vijay Karnataka, also play a significant role in catering to the linguistic diversity of the country.

Regional and Local News Sources
In addition to the prominent national news sources in India, there are numerous regional and local news sources that cater to specific regions, cities, and towns. These sources provide in-depth coverage of local issues, events, and news that may not receive national attention. Here are some notable regional and local news sources in India:
North India
The Times of India’s regional editions, such as the Times of India (Delhi), Times of India (Mumbai), and Times of India (Chandigarh), provide comprehensive coverage of local news in their respective regions. Other notable sources include the Hindustan Times (Delhi), the Tribune (Chandigarh), and the Punjab Kesari (Jodhpur).
South India
The Hindu, a leading English-language daily, has regional editions in cities like Chennai, Bangalore, and Hyderabad. Other prominent sources in South India include the Deccan Chronicle (Hyderabad), the New Indian Express (Chennai), and the Times of India (Bangalore).
East India
The Telegraph (Kolkata) and the Statesman (Kolkata) are prominent sources in East India, providing coverage of local news and events in the region. Other notable sources include the Assam Tribune (Guwahati), the Telegraph (Guwahati), and the Times of India (Kolkata).
West India
The Mumbai edition of the Times of India, the Mumbai Mirror, and the Mid-Day are prominent sources in West India, providing coverage of local news and events in the region. Other notable sources include the DNA (Mumbai), the Indian Express (Mumbai), and the Hindustan Times (Mumbai).
